Hmm. Upon second inspection, it seems the advice in my previous post doesn't apply to your situation.

 

The master files must be there, because whatever is placed into those form lists and leveled lists doesn't exist in the merged patch, only in their original files.

 

For example:

 

Mod X adds a weapon to the game and places it into Leveled List Y, thereby overriding that list. Mod Z adds another weapon to the game and also places it into Leveled List Y, thereby overriding it a second time. Both mods cannot place items into Leveled List Y without one overriding the other, so a merged patch is made. In the merged patch, a third override to Leveled List Y is made, containing the weapons from both Mod X and Mod Z. But those weapons still originate in their respective original plugins, so the master dependency to those are necessary.

 

In short: you don't need to clean the master files on your merged patch.
